Nitrate Metabolism and Ischemic Cerebrovascular Disease: A Narrative Review
Inorganic and organic nitrates are present in vivo and in vitro. Inorganic nitrate is considered a pool of nitric oxide (NO), but it can be converted into nitrite and NO through various mechanisms.
